Influencing and Negotiating
Course Description:

This experiential course will introduce you to theories of influencing and negotiating and combines the intellectual rigour of discussing academic research, with exercises and practical implementation of the associated skills.

  • Influencing techniques
  • Emotional intelligence
  • Transactional analysis
  • Rapport
  • Negotiation theory
  • Toolbox of negotiation techniques
  • Relevant case studies

Objectives:
  • Better influence your colleagues, research group, and key stakeholders
  • Conduct effective negotiations with colleagues and collaborators
  • Discuss and apply leading theories underpinning influencing and negotiation
  • Reflect on how the material applies to your situation and plan what changes to make
